The comments for our local paper were toxic. I cannot describe how horrible they were. They were racist and abusive. People would make vile comments when there would be a story about someone dying in a car accident. There were even some public hearings because they got so out of hand. The worst were made by a small group, and many people suspect at least some of them didn't even live in the area.

 

Anyway, about three years ago the paper got rid of anonymous commenting.  All people wanting to comment have to log in via their facebook account. Boom. End of abusive commenting. There might be some chilling of free speech with the loss of anonymous commenting, but people were cancelling their subscriptions to the paper and the paper itself was becoming the story. Something really had to be done because it was just beyond acceptable. Threats had been made to people, the police had got involved, it was just nasty.
